Transaction 9602045d42250919c52d96ecffab3b187596bb42b975313fe12b9554e002ef28
4 Input
2 Outputs
- 9602045d42250919c52d96ecffab3b187596bb42b975313fe12b9554e002ef28:0
- 9602045d42250919c52d96ecffab3b187596bb42b975313fe12b9554e002ef28:1
value 180703080
address 31orAB2ozK5MJ1N3sinoVPqib27uUrAWZs
value 58879920
address 181voKPh4fvRqjop9mfySUemAPHq2NEKhQ